Whamcloud - gitweb
LU-15374 tests: check FULL and IDLE for client import state 98/49298/4
authorJian Yu <yujian@whamcloud.com>
Thu, 13 Apr 2023 06:16:51 +0000 (23:16 -0700)
committerOleg Drokin <green@whamcloud.com>
Sat, 22 Apr 2023 17:29:27 +0000 (17:29 +0000)
commit25fb82eb413389b6023e0e61f7efb71e91d15c01
tree01587b0dded7c93d14bfc7a5a9509bb93b802e00
parent5edb883b44ac707528ce2c0bc812d65b9ffb4a50
LU-15374 tests: check FULL and IDLE for client import state

The client-to-OST import state can be FULL or IDLE.

Test-Parameters: trivial testgroup=review-dne-part-3

Test-Parameters: trivial env=SLOW=no,FAILURE_MODE=HARD \
clientcount=4 mdtcount=1 mdscount=2 osscount=2 \
austeroptions=-R failover=true iscsi=1 \
testlist=recovery-mds-scale

Fixes: 25606a2ce1 ("LU-15342 tests: escape "|"")
Fixes: 3da8f014fd ("LU-12857 tests: allow clients to be IDLE after recovery")
Fixes: 5a6ceb664f ("LU-7236 ptlrpc: idle connections can disconnect")

Change-Id: I3582ceb273d241ee71fe907f6d1423746e453faa
Signed-off-by: Jian Yu <yujian@whamcloud.com>
Reviewed-on: https://review.whamcloud.com/c/fs/lustre-release/+/49298
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Andreas Dilger <adilger@whamcloud.com>
Reviewed-by: Alex Deiter <alex.deiter@gmail.com>
Reviewed-by: Alex Zhuravlev <bzzz@whamcloud.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>
lustre/tests/conf-sanity.sh
lustre/tests/recovery-mds-scale.sh
lustre/tests/test-framework.sh